I am quite amazed that aircraft can just disappear. Here in New Zealand we have mandatory emergency beacons fitted in all aircraft which transmit through the satellite system on 406mhz and can be turned on manually from the cockpit in an emergency and also have a g switch which can turn them on automatically on impact. The shortcoming of the latter is that the exterior transmitting aerial may break off in an accident thus preventing an adequate signal being sent from the distressed aircraft. Because of this, those of us here that fly - especially in remote areas, have for many years fitted on board tracking devices such as SPOT. Spidertrack or Trackplus. These units are small in size, simple to install and relatively cheap insurance with the latter costing the operators less than NZD$5 per hour on average to run. Smaller GA operators of fixed wing and helicopters in this area set their devices to give a position every two minutes or so and the latter two devices quoted show speed. al
